Post subject: Re: something is different, base

FSX base airport KORS Orcas Island



plane crash
N48° 35.45' W122° 38.83'

JG300 secret airfield
N48° 43.49' W122° 42.03'

Floatplane dock

N48° 42.52' W122° 56.71'

improved bush airstrip and Stoopy's paint shop

N48° 42.66' W123° 1.09'

Campground

N48° 42.09' W123° 3.87'

CV-4 USS Ranger

N48° 55.19' W123° 4.39'

Ghost Plane ??????

Ghost Ship ??????




and not included but usable ( location might end up slightly different) is the
USS Mispillion Fleet Oiler AO-105 Orcas Island from Hovercontrol

Post subject: Re: something is different, base

the ghost ship is submerged in a fixed position. the ghost plane is a TBF (also sunken) to the left of the main Orcas runway, relatively close to the shoreline.

If you are talking about the base in mountain lake, for some reason best known to the person who designed the concrete slab scenery (not me by the way) didn't harden it, so all the items actually had to be positioned "floating" above the lake surface (real PIA, by the way)
